Overview

It's spawned countless video games for the PC, a David Lynch-directed movie, and countless pieces of collectible merchandise. Now, the science fiction classic that's captured the hearts and minds of a few generations returns in its most detailed video game incarnation ever: FRANK HERBERT'S DUNE for the PlayStation 2. The story is set in the year 10191, a time when the Houses of Atreides and Harkonnen fight for ultimate control of the sandy planet, Arrakis. The planet has but one resource known as Spice which a long life and great power for anyone who is fortunate enough to possess it. Unfortunately, the substance is in high demand, which has led to this unfortunate war. As Paul, the son of the Duke of Atreides (and rightful heir to the throne), you'll need to join forces with the native Fremen and conquer the armies of the evil Baron Harkonnen once and for all, avenging the massacre of the Atreides. You'll be accompanied by dozens of noble, nomadic Fremen warriors in your attempt to return the land of Arrakis to a state of healthy fertility.
